    Explore the thin line between love and hate! After their whirl wind courtship, Paul and Corie begin their new life together in an old fifth floor walk-up apartment, which Corie has picked out and Paul sees for the first time on their return from the honeymoon. She is a free-spirited young wife and he is a serious young lawyer. Add her somewhat prudish mother and the charming, yet strange, upstairs neighbor and you get a delightful comedy! The laughs are non-stop as these two complete opposites try to adjust to life as husband and wife. The trials and tribulations of the couple's marital bliss come to a comic explosion when Paul refuses to join Corie for a barefoot walk through a snowy park. The laughs are non-stop in this Neil Simon comedy. Helpful Information: Student rush $15 seating 20 minutes prior to show. Pending ticket availability.

        I saw Seussical Jr. at Scottsdale Desert Stages Theatre, (A Theatre in the Round) Last Friday, there are 4 casts and I saw Early (Openining) Cast, and it was a blast! Directed by Bill Atkinson, who did a good job directing the show with the challenge of in the round theatre, but I had 1 issue, in the scene Solla Sollew I watched the back of Hortons head and had to crane my neck to see the Who Family. Choreography by Tiffany Atkinson, and Madison McDonald, which overall I didnt like, but some of it was good like Havin' a Hunch. Standout Performers: Jojo, has the most beautiful voice I've ever heard on a young boy and good acting skills, Gertrude who had a beautiful voice and had the appropriate awkwardness, Mayzie, who along with Jojo was my favorite performer. My main issue with the performance was there seemed to be little Music Direction! It had a fun set! See this Show! Collapse

        I had my doubts about men portraying the nuns. Yes there is a tiny amount of falsetto work in order to keep the illusion alive, but not to the point of distraction. Each "sister" has their strengths and uses them to the utmost. There are only two points in the show that needed improvement: I wish Sister Amnesia's puppet had workable arms, and the line "Sister Julia...Child of God" should be read "Sister Julia Child...of God" in order to really drive home the classic cooking show reference. Other than that the Reverand Mother's look of dissaproval is priceless and the "Dying Nun" ballet is fantastic! It's the first time I've seen it done like that and now I wouldn't want to see it any other way! Go see the show if you've had a bad day, because this will make you forget all about it. Promise.         I saw the opening late cast last sunday at Desert Stages Theatre, I told you that because there are four different casts! The first thing you notice when you walk in the theatre is the FANTASTIC set! The show was written by the founder of the theatre Gerry Cullity who added roles for lots of children, audience interaction, great songs, and witty dialouge. Perfect for this theatre. The costumes were all made by the parents of the children in the show, and they were good. Starring as Cinderella was Desiree Vaughan who had a beautiful voice! The prince was played by A.J. Costa. The two cute but mean stepsisters played by Tillea Baltzell and Kristin Alba who brought great humor to their roles. The four italian mice all were very funny! All in all a magical production. That I highly recomend you go see! Collapse
